Abstract

The present invention relates to novel drugs which may be used in combating infectious micro-organisms, particularly bacteria. More specifically, the invention relates to peptide nucleic acid (PNA) sequences that are modified by conjugating cationic peptides to the PNA moiety in order to obtain novel PNA molecules that exhibit enhanced anti-infective properties

         5 . A modified peptide nucleic acid (PNA) molecule having formula (I):  
       Peptide-L-PNA  (I)  
       wherein L is a linker or a bond, Peptide is any amino acid sequence, and PNA is a peptide nucleic acid.  
     
     
         6 . The modified PNA molecule of  claim 5  wherein Peptide is a cationic peptide or peptide analog or a functionally similar moiety having formula (II):  
       C-(B-A) n -D,  (II)  
       wherein: 
 A is from 1 to 8 non-charged amino acids and/or amino acid analogs;  
 B is from 1 to 3 positively charged amino acids and/or amino acid analogs;  
 C is from 0 to 4 non-charged amino acids and/or amino acid analogs;  
 D is from 0 to 3 positively charged amino acids and/or amino acid analogs; and  
 n is 1-10;  
 wherein the total number of amino acids and/or amino acid analogs is from 3 to 20.
